The Internal Revenue Service (IRS) has a requirement for Double-Take Software and NSI Professional Services. This is a combined synopsis/solicitation for commercial items prepared in accordance with the format in the Federal Acquisition Regulation (FAR) Subpart 12.6, as supplemented with additional information included in this notice. This announcement constitutes the only solicitation for this requirement; proposals are being requested and a written solicitation will not be issued. No solicitation document exists and requests for same will be considered non-responsive. This solicitation is issued as a Request for Quotes (RFQ) and the solicitation number is TIRNO-08-Q-00119. The solicitation document and incorporated provisions and clauses are those in effect through Federal Acquisition Circular 05-21. The IRS has a need for the following items: CLIN 0001- Double-Take Server Recovery Option with first year maintenance, Item Number DT4-SRO-AO, Quantity 2 CLIN 0002 – Double-Take Server Edition with first year maintenance, Item Number DT4AS-PRE-B, Quantity 14 CLIN 0003 – NSI Professional Services-Implementation for two Double-Take for Windows Licenses, Item Number PS-Implem-C00, Quantity 2. The IRS-Office of Chief Counsel has a need to use the brand-name “Double-Take” software because of the following reasons: 1.Double-Take software provides multiple levels of data compression, rather than a simple on/off, which gives the ability to set compression levels based on the type of data and replication requirements unlike all other replication products. 2.Unlike all other replication products, Double-Take software has better flexibility in allowing different scheduling settings per replications set, as opposed to having one scheduling setting for all sets. 3.Double-Take software provides full support for New Technology File System (NTFS) encrypted files unlike other replication products. 4.Double-Take software supports File/Print, Exchange, and SQL server replication with the same license unlike other replication products. 5.Unlike other replication products, Double-Take software supports both Full Server Failover of files and applications, as well as Server Recovery Option to recover the entire server contents, including the operating system. 6.Double-Take software is one of the few replication products with multiple Microsoft certifications and is the industry leader in data replication software.
